Pros & Cons

✅ Meshy Pros

• Generates results in seconds — text-to-3d runs noticeably faster than manual alternatives

• Image-to-3D is genuinely impressive — especially for text-to-3d workflows where Meshy consistently outperforms manual approaches

• Game-engine-ready output formats — especially for text-to-3d workflows where Meshy consistently outperforms manual approaches

• 1M+ users, well-proven platform — especially for text-to-3d workflows where Meshy consistently outperforms manual approaches

❌ Cons

• Organic shapes (characters, creatures) can look wavy

• High polygon counts need manual optimisation

✅ Tripo3D Pros

• Cleaner topology than most competitors

• Generates results in seconds — text-to-3d runs noticeably faster than manual alternatives

• Rigging-ready character output — especially for text-to-3d workflows where Tripo3D consistently outperforms manual approaches

• Strong on mechanical and hard-surface objects

❌ Cons

• Fewer users and community resources than Meshy

• Texturing less detailed on organic surfaces
